Output 6f15322bb1d8b5e0fd23ecca04e2e0b863bb13c65ef0b94636141a92a0c019b3:3

value
1342396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f31a9ab86565d156cf9c4f65772dd61a31130ede OP_EQUAL
address
3PrRzfQcTPrrJWcnb6Gr9UG1Fr9G4qTmb4
transaction
6f15322bb1d8b5e0fd23ecca04e2e0b863bb13c65ef0b94636141a92a0c019b3